RFK Jr: “We Have 4.2% of the Global Population. How Come We Had 16% of the COVID Deaths?”
“Whatever they [US health authorities] were doing was catastrophic.”
COVID death rate by country:
• US - 3,000 per million population
• Haiti - 15 per million population
• Nigeria - 14 per million population
The argument against such figures is that Haiti and Nigeria have much younger populations, which is true. But if you look at Japan, which “has the oldest population in the world, and it had 1/10th the death rate that we did.”
Kennedy concluded, “It was not a public health response. It was a militarized and monetized response to a public health crisis.”
